Question 133769: A high school class wants to raise money by recycling newspapers. The class decided to rent a truck at a cost of $150 for the week. The market price for recycled newspapers is $15 per ton. Write an equation representing the amount of money the class will make based on the number of tons of newspapers collected. You can put this solution on YOUR website! The amount of money the class makes is called the profit and profit is the difference between the money received, called revenue, and the cost of doing business, called cost.
.
In this example, there is only one cost element, the truck rental of $150. In other words, And there is only one revenue element, $15 for every ton of newspaper. The total revenue is the number of tons of newspaper collected times $15, and if x represents the number of tons, 15x represents the revenue from x tons, so
